BACKGROUND. Newer-generation drug-eluting stents (DES) remain associated with late stent-related adverse events at approximately 2% per year, driven by neoatherosclerosis, delayed endothelial healing, and chronic inflammation attributable to permanent polymer coatings. Polymer-free DES were developed to remove this substrate. The polymer-free sirolimus-based submicron carrier-eluting stent Focus np (Abluminus np, Concept Medical, Tampa, FL, USA) (after: study device) is a novel polymer-free sirolimus-eluting stent built on a thin-strut (73 micrometres) cobalt-chromium platform, with drug delivery via biodegradable phospholipid submicron carriers (200-300 nm) confined to the abluminal surface, and a proprietary fusion coating extending sirolimus up to 5 mm beyond the stent edges. The device received CE marking on 24 January 2020. Only limited non-randomized Indian clinical data exist; no Western clinical data have been published.
OBJECTIVES. Primary: to evaluate device-oriented safety and efficacy (TLF at 12 months) of the stent in an all-comer population undergoing PCI at Geneva University Hospitals. Secondary: TLF at 2 and 5 years; individual components of TLF (cardiac death, target vessel MI, clinically indicated target lesion revascularisation) at 30 days, 12 months, 2 years, and 5 years; patient-oriented composite endpoint (all-cause death, any MI, any revascularisation); stent thrombosis (definite / probable, ARC-2, with temporal classification); target vessel failure; major bleeding (BARC 3 or 5); all-cause mortality; and late lumen loss when angiographic follow-up is available.
DESIGN. Prospective, single-centre, single-arm observational registry (Category A research with human subjects per the Swiss Human Research Act). Hybrid enrolment: retrospective identification from January 2021, prospective consent, and prospective follow-up at 30 days, 12 months, 2 years, and 5 years via medical records and telephone interview.
POPULATION. All consecutive adult patients (>= 18 years) treated with at least one study device stent at Geneva University Hospitals since January 2021, with an indication for PCI according to current European or American guidelines, able to provide written informed consent, and with sufficient knowledge of French, German, English, or Italian.
STATISTICS. Exploratory, descriptive analysis. Binary endpoints with Clopper-Pearson 95% confidence intervals; time-to-event analysis by Kaplan-Meier with Greenwood 95% CIs. Pre-specified exploratory subgroup analyses (sex, clinical presentation, diabetes, age, lesion complexity, stent length) presented as forest plots without between-group p-values. Sensitivity analyses include per-protocol, complete-case, landmark (30 days to 12 months), Fine-Gray competing-risk, and tipping point analyses. Analyses in Python (lifelines, pandas, scipy, statsmodels). Reporting follows STROBE.

Inclusion Criteria:
- Age >= 18 years at the time of the index procedure.
- Percutaneous coronary intervention performed at Geneva University Hospitals between January 2021 and December 2025.
- Implantation of at least one study device
- Indication for PCI according to current European or American guidelines.
- Able and willing to provide written informed consent.
- Sufficient knowledge of French, German, English, or Italian to understand the patient information document.
Exclusion Criteria:
- Documented refusal to participate in research through opt-out from general consent.
- Inability to provide informed consent (cognitive impairment or other).
- Inability to be contacted for informed consent (no valid contact information, or unreachable after three contact attempts).
- Life expectancy less than 12 months due to non-cardiac comorbidities at the time of consent.
- Participation in another clinical trial that would interfere with the endpoints of this registry.
